Finished Not movie version of Conan from Repaer Bones
« on: May 18, 2019, 02:44:32 PM »
With the clouds I did not think that I would get a good picture of the tree but there was a break in the cloud cover and I got these.  The tree is still a WIP as it needs some oils and basing.  It is the Tree of Despair model from Reapers latest kickcstarter.  I replaced the ropes on not Conans wrists and linked them with some rope knots that were sculpted on the ends of the branches.  Painted with a mix of craft, GW and Privateer paints.

They will be.  Generally Reaper does a Kickstarter and the models are released in slow time over about a year to a year and a half from the time the KS ships.  Some get released pretty quick some it takes a while.  Here are the contents.

KS price was $12 so I would guess about $20-25 retail.

I am sure I read it in one of the early books see  http://vaultofevil.proboards.com/thread/2075/conan-tree-death-thomas-buscema#ixzz5pCxmmnpP 

The idea is from Marvel's Savage Sword of Conan No 5, April 1975.The story is a 60 page plus adaptation of R E Howard's "A Witch Shall Be Born".
